Noun: kidney vetch
  1. Perennial Eurasian herb having heads of red or yellow flowers and common in meadows and pastures; formerly used medicinally for kidney disorders
    "Kidney vetch still grows abundantly in European meadows";
    - Anthyllis vulneraria

Derived forms: kidney vetches

Type of: herb, herbaceous plant

Part of: Anthyllis, genus Anthyllis
